Live dealer games have changed the online casino industry. They blend the convenience of online play with the authentic atmosphere of a land-based casino. This fosters a more immersive and trustworthy experience compared to traditional RNG-based games.

Singapore: A newer player on the scene, Singapore has quickly established itself with two massive integrated resorts, Marina Bay Sands and Resorts World Sentosa, which are architectural marvels.

Blackjack is one of the few casino games where strategy can significantly impact the outcome. While luck always plays a part, knowing basic strategy can lower the house edge and casino (our homepage) boost your chances of winning. The aim is simple: casino get a hand value closer to 21 than the dealer without going over.

Bonus Detail
Wagering Requirement
Calculation
$100 bonus
20x the bonus
$100 x 20 = $2,000
$100 bonus (from a $100 deposit)
30x the bonus + deposit
($100 + $100) x 30 = $6,000
50 Free Spins (winnings are bonus cash)
40x the winnings
If you win $20, you must wager $20 x 40 = $800
Always read the terms and conditions. Look for wagering requirements, game restrictions (some games contribute less to wagering), and time limits before accepting any bonus.

The first known European gambling house, the Ridotto, was established in Venice, Italy, in 1638. Its purpose was to control and regulate gambling during the carnival season. The Story of Casinos
The notion of the casino has a rich and captivating history, dating back centuries. From these early beginnings, the casino concept spread across Europe and eventually to the Americas.
